Business Insider reports that US Army soldiers are using ruggedized Samsung-based End User Devices to map locations, share information, and test digital command-and-control tools during training.
The US Army is using chest-mounted End User Devices, described as stripped, ruggedized, and reprogrammed Samsung phones, as part of its push toward a more digital battlefield. At a recent exercise, soldiers used the devices to plot movements, check locations, communicate, and support faster decision-making. The devices reflect the Army’s broader shift toward commercially available technology adapted for military use.
During Project Convergence Capstone at Fort Irwin in California, roughly 10,000 soldiers trained in simulated large-scale combat while testing technologies including drones, electronic warfare systems, and Next Generation Command and Control. Soldiers carried EUDs in chest-mounted carriers, powered by batteries on their backs. Loaded with Android Team Awareness Kit, the devices provided real-time geospatial maps, friendly-force locations, rough enemy locations, map markers, photos, and chat tools.
The devices can connect through multiple paths, including satellite or cellular networks, and some apps can function offline if soldiers lose connection or face jamming. But troops also encountered connectivity issues during the exercise, including problems linked to simulated electronic warfare and other causes. The takeaway is practical: digital tools can speed decisions, but soldiers still need analog backups such as physical maps when networks fail.
The Army is still assessing how many EUDs different formations need and how far down the chain the devices should be distributed. Business Insider reports that the 25th Infantry Division has almost 2,200 devices, while other divisions, including the 4th Infantry Division, have fewer. Army leaders are weighing which soldiers benefit most, with unit commanders noted as likely users for movement and communication, while future applications could include medical, logistics, photo, and video tools.
